I don't know about your laptop, but I know that some models have a outlet in the back that you can use to connect it to a actual computer monitor. I know the Goodwill in Galion has a lot of computer monitors on the cheap, so you may be able to buy one and hook it up. However, that is entirely dependent on your laptop's configuration. I think I might have found something that may help, but it may not. I know you said your computer is an older HP but it might still be relevant.
Sometimes HP installs a hkey.exe program on their computers. Basically it means that it has some things specific to the laptop hotkeyed, such as the power saving or the monitors lighten/darken function. The examples I found were holding the "Fn" key and pressing F7/F8 or the down arrow key or up arrow key to darken and lightening the screen. It may be a different key to hold or a different combination on your computer.
I'm hoping this works, as it sounds like a software issue rather than a hardware. Mainly because there are more things likely to go out during a surge than your monitor, such as the power supply or the processor. Also, if it did go out, it would more likely killed your screen than just dim it. So try that, or give me more information and I might be able to look into it further.
You can also try unplugging your laptop from the power cord. From some I read that seems to brighten the screen too.
